Streamlining Operations with RPA

Robotic Process Automation involves the use of software robots or artificial intelligence workers to automate repetitive tasks and processes that were once performed by humans. By deploying these robots, industries can significantly streamline their operations, resulting in improved efficiency and accuracy. Some of the key benefits of RPA in enhancing industrial workflows are:

  • Increased Productivity: RPA allows industries to automate monotonous and time-consuming tasks, freeing up human resources to focus on more complex and creative work. As a result, productivity levels soar, leading to faster turnaround times and increased output.
  • Error Reduction: Human error is a common occurrence in repetitive tasks. By incorporating RPA, industries can eliminate the risk of errors and minimize the costs associated with rework or rectification.
  • Improved Quality: RPA ensures consistency and accuracy in performing tasks. It eliminates variations caused by human factors, resulting in improved quality control and standardization in industrial processes.
  • Cost Savings: Implementing RPA reduces labor costs and the need for additional human resources. Industries can achieve significant cost savings by automating tasks that were previously carried out manually.

The Impact of RPA in Different Industries

Robotic Process Automation has made a profound impact across various industries, revolutionizing traditional workflows and bringing about exceptional efficiency gains. Let's take a closer look at some industrial sectors benefiting from RPA:

Manufacturing:

In the manufacturing industry, RPA can be used to automate repetitive tasks such as assembly line operations, quality inspections, and inventory management. By automating these processes, manufacturers can improve production rates, reduce errors, and enhance overall operational efficiency.

Logistics and Supply Chain:

RPA offers immense benefits to the logistics and supply chain sector by automating tasks such as order processing, shipment tracking, and inventory management. These automations optimize processes, ensure real-time visibility, and reduce delays, resulting in faster and smoother operations.

Healthcare:

Integrating RPA in healthcare workflows enables efficient management of patient records, medical billing, appointment scheduling, and claims processing. By automating these processes, healthcare providers can improve patient care, reduce administrative burden, and enhance overall service quality.

Finance and Banking:

RPA is widely adopted in finance and banking institutions to automate tasks such as transaction processing, compliance reports, and customer onboarding. By employing automation, financial institutions can improve accuracy, minimize the risk of fraud, and enhance customer experience.

What is Robotic Process Automation?

Robotic Process Automation, commonly known as RPA, refers to the use of software robots or ""bots"" to automate repetitive and rule-based tasks that were traditionally performed by humans. These bots mimic human actions and interact with digital systems, applications, and data, effectively reducing the need for human intervention in mundane tasks.

Applications of RPA in Industries

  • Streamlined Workflow: RPA can streamline and automate complex workflows, optimizing and accelerating processes. It can perform tasks such as data entry, invoice processing, report generation, and more with great precision and reliability.
  • Customer Service: By automating customer service processes, organizations can improve response times, reduce errors, and enhance customer satisfaction. RPA can assist with tasks like customer onboarding, order processing, and query resolution.
  • Finance and Accounting: RPA has a significant impact on finance and accounting departments, automating tasks such as accounts payable, accounts receivable, financial reporting, and compliance. This not only ensures accuracy but also frees up valuable time for strategic financial planning.
  • Human Resources: RPA can automate HR processes, including employee onboarding, payroll processing, leave management, and performance appraisals. This allows HR professionals to focus on more strategic initiatives, such as talent acquisition and retention.

Statistics Show the Power of RPA

Let's take a look at some industry statistics that highlight the impact of RPA:

  • According to Deloitte Consulting LLP, RPA has the potential to reduce operational costs by 25-50%.
  • In a survey by the Institute for Robotic Process Automation and Artificial Intelligence (IRPA AI), 78% of respondents reported that they had achieved an ROI from RPA implementation within a year.
  • Research conducted by McKinsey & Company suggests that by 2025, up to 45% of workplace activities can be automated, leading to a significant boost in productivity.

Improved Safety and Risk Mitigation

Industrial processes often involve hazardous tasks that pose risks to human workers. Automation can greatly enhance workplace safety and mitigate occupational hazards by removing or minimizing human involvement in risky operations.

  • Reduced accidents: Automated systems can handle dangerous tasks, reducing the risk of accidents and injuries to human workers.
  • Enhanced ergonomics: Automation can alleviate the physical strain associated with repetitive or strenuous tasks, improving worker well-being.
  • Emergency response: Automated systems can be programmed to respond swiftly to emergencies, minimizing potential damages.
